Neste post, ensinaremos sobre números de ponto flutuante, por que são chamados assim e como são representados. Também exploraremos conceitos-chave como mantissa e discutiremos como esses números são usados na computação.
Como é chamado o ponto flutuante?
Um ponto flutuante é um método para representar números reais em computação que inclui uma parte fracionária. É denominado “flutuante” porque a vírgula decimal pode se mover (“flutuar”) dependendo do valor do número, permitindo a representação de uma ampla gama de magnitudes. Os números de ponto flutuante são uma parte essencial da computação moderna, especialmente em áreas que exigem alta precisão, como cálculos científicos e financeiros.
Por que é chamado de ponto flutuante?
O termo “ponto flutuante” vem da flexibilidade da vírgula decimal na representação do número. Ao contrário dos números de ponto fixo, onde o ponto decimal é definido em uma posição específica, os números de ponto flutuante permitem que o decimal “flutue” com base no expoente. Essa flutuação permite que o sistema represente números muito grandes e muito pequenos com alto grau de precisão. A natureza flutuante torna possível realizar cálculos em uma ampla gama de magnitudes, desde frações minúsculas até valores enormes.
Qual é a diferença entre um somador completo e um meio somador?
O que é um número de ponto flutuante?
Um número de ponto flutuante é um número que pode representar números inteiros e reais com partes fracionárias. Esses números são compostos de três partes principais: um bit de sinal (que indica se o número é positivo ou negativo), um expoente (que ajusta a magnitude do número) e uma mantissa (que contém os dígitos significativos do número). Esta estrutura permite que números de ponto flutuante manipulem valores muito pequenos ou muito grandes de forma eficiente, mas introduz a possibilidade de erros de arredondamento porque nem todos os valores decimais podem ser representados com precisão na forma binária.
O que é mantissa de ponto flutuante?
A mantissa, também conhecida como significando, é a parte de um número de ponto flutuante que contém seus dígitos significativos. Numa representação de ponto flutuante, a mantissa é combinada com o expoente para determinar o valor global do número. Quanto maior o número de bits alocados à mantissa, maior será a precisão do número de ponto flutuante. No entanto, aumentar o tamanho da mantissa acarreta o custo do uso de mais memória, o que pode ser uma desvantagem em ambientes com memória restrita.
Como um número de ponto flutuante é representado?
Um número de ponto flutuante é representado em binário usando um formato específico, normalmente seguindo o padrão IEEE 754. O número é dividido em três partes: o bit de sinal, o expoente e a mantissa. O bit de sinal indica se o número é positivo ou negativo. O expoente determina até que ponto o ponto decimal deve “flutuar” em relação à sua posição base. Por fim, a mantissa contém os algarismos significativos, normalizados de forma que o primeiro algarismo seja sempre diferente de zero, garantindo o uso eficiente do espaço. Esta representação permite um equilíbrio entre alcance e precisão, mas também pode introduzir desafios, como erros de arredondamento em determinadas operações.
Esperamos que esta explicação tenha ajudado você a compreender os aspectos fundamentais dos números de ponto flutuante e como eles funcionam. Obter uma compreensão clara desse conceito é fundamental ao trabalhar com dados numéricos em computação.